Abstract :
This paper discusses a method to find the acoustic properties of different types of background noise: highway, airport, subway, restaurant, rain, inside a car, and inside a train. Four parameters are calculated using the auto correlation function (ACF). These parameters are energy (at the origin of delay phi(0)) the amplitude of the first positive peak of the ACF (phiFP), tauPF (delay of phiFP), the amplitude of the first negative peak of the ACF (phiFN).
